Job Duties
- Greet and welcome customers as soon as they arrive at the office in a professional manner
- create intake for new customers
- direct customers to the appropriate attorney or paralegal
- answer, screen, and forward incoming phone calls
- ensure the reception area is tidy and presentable with all necessary stationery and materials
- provide basic and accurate information in person and via phone or email
- assist in receiving, sorting, and distributing daily mail or deliveries
- update calendars and schedule clients
- perform other clerical receptionist duties such as filing, photocopying, transcribing, and faxing
